. If you have never heard Ajalon, their blend of folk and prog-rock establishes their unique inventive sound. Featuring members, Randy George (Neal Morse, Salem Hill) and Wil Henderson, and Dan Lile, the album is chalked full of guests. Among these are, Rick Wakeman (Yes), Neal Morse and Phil Keaggy!!!
With the release of their second CD, On the Threshold of Eternity will offer a different view of Ajalon’s music, while maintaining the trademark sound that was established with the first release. The songs once again will feature the grand scale composition merged with the delicate heart cry of the acoustic folk ballad. 67 minutes of challenging music will take you on a journey that will no doubt leave you singing the songs as you travel your life’s journey. The bonus track on the album is Ajalon’s sparkling rendition of an old Moody Blues classic, “You and Me” from the Seventh Sojourn CD. You’ll love it!
